How much do weekend busser j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end busser in Hawaii is $13.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$10.72 and $15.72 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end busser?

Weekend bussers are restaurant staff responsible for clearing tables, resetting them for new guests, and assisting servers during weekends, which are typically busy periods. Their main duties include removing dirty dishes, wiping down tables and chairs, refilling water glasses, and sometimes helping with basic cleaning tasks. Bussers play a key role in ensuring a smooth dining experience by keeping the dining area tidy and supporting the waitstaff. Working as a weekend busser often involves fast-paced work and excellent teamwork sk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end busser,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Busser, you need strong attention to detail, basic food service knowledge,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ment; no formal education is typically required, but prior experience in hospitality is a plus. Familiarity with point-of-sale systems and health and safety regulations can be beneficial. Excellent teamwork, communication, and a positive attitude help you stand out in this role. These skills ensure customer satisfaction, smooth restaurant operations, and a clean, welcoming dining environment.

What are the main challenges a weekend busser might face during peak hours, and how can they effectively handle them?

Weekend Bussers often encounter high guest volumes and fast-paced environments, especially during meal rushes. The main challenges include clearing tables quickly, resetting them efficiently, and coordinating with servers and kitchen staff to ensure smooth service. To handle these demands, it's important to stay organized, communicate clearly with team members, and remain calm under pressure. Developing good time management and multitasking skills will help you maintain a clean dining area and support the overall guest experience.

What is the difference between Weekend Busser vs Part-Time Server?

AspectWeekend BusserPart-Time Server
ResponsibilitiesClearing tables, resetting, assisting serversTaking orders, serving food and drinks, handling payments
Required SkillsTeamwork, basic customer serviceCustomer service, communication, multitasking
Work EnvironmentRestaurant dining area, fast-pacedRestaurant dining area, customer interaction
CredentialsNone typically requiredNone typically required, but some establishments prefer experience

Weekend Bussers focus on supporting the service team by maintaining cleanliness and efficiency, while Part-Time Servers directly interact with customers by taking orders and serving food. Both roles are common in restaurant settings and require good customer service skills, but their responsibilities differ significantly.

Job description

Title: Busser (Dinner)
Employment Type: Hourly
Pay Rate: $12.75/hour PLUS TIPS!!

Job Description:
The Busser helps provide exceptional dining service to customers in a timely, courteous, efficient, and accurate manner. He or she sets and resets dining room tables to maximize prompt table availability for our customers, removes plates, glassware, and silverware when customers are finished with them, and quickly and efficiently re-stocks dishes and glassware. In addition, the busser helps with other tasks including washing dishes, cleaning, and emptying trash, and maintaining restrooms.  The Busser is polite and friendly to guests, wait staff, and management and must follow proper sanitation standards and keep his or her workstation clean and sanitary at all times.
Responsibilities:
  • Sets up dining areas before beginning shift and cleans dining areas after
  • Clears tables of used dishes, glasses, and silverware and re-sets between customers
  • Maintains work area in a neat and organized manner
  • Ensures a proper supply of clean dishware, utensils, and glassware to stock the dining room and set tables
